CarDekho launches new store in Udaipur, India

CarDekho, an auto retail and auction platform, recently opened up a brand new store in Udaipur, India. The new store is apart of a grander strategy from CarDekho to open over 200 of their Gaadi store through India by 2020. 

The company already has 56 stores in Delhi-NCR, Bangalore, Jaipur, Pune, Lucknow, Ahmedabad, Hyderabad, Karnal and Mumbai. The opening of the store coincided with the opening of a similar store in Jodhpur.

CarDekho Gaadi is gradually expanding its reach in Rajasthan. Udaipur is a historic city and attracts tourists from across the globe. The city has been witnessing a surge in car sales, especially of pre-owned cars. The store aims to be a one-stop destination for customers in the market for pre-owned cars. It will also help customers with RC transfer, loan closure assistance, instant money transfer, and methodical inspection of cars.

Vibhor Sahare, Co-Founder and CEO Gaadi com said, “We have been receiving phenomenal market response on our CarDekho Gaadi stores. Our rapidly increasing operations in cities across the country reaffirm our belief in this segment. The store in Udaipur is part of tour plan to increase our footprint in Rajasthan. Using our expertise in the used car ecosystem, we will continue to build a trusted platform for selling used cars in India.”

According to a study by McKinsey & Company, the used-cars segment in India will continue to grow. It has already become Asia’s third-largest car market. In the last fiscal year, 4 million second-hand cars were bought and sold in the country. Besides, due to the growing focus on the lifespan of cars and stricter norms on emissions and safety, and the upcoming launch of multiple electronic cars, people are wary of purchasing new vehicles.
